FBI agents raided the homicide division of the New Orleans Police Department last week as part of a federal probe into a deadly bridge shooting in the aftermath of Hurricane Katrina.
FBI agents seized two computers and case files from the department during a search of the office. The FBI is investigating officers involved in the September 4, 2005 shootings on the Danziger Bridge that killed two men and injured four.
